The parties discussed prospects for the company's participation in implementing investment projects in Uzbekistan across the energy, industrial, and logistics infrastructure sectors.
Du Yonghong stated that the San Bao Corporation has been operating in Central Asia markets for over 30 years and possesses significant expertise in implementing energy and industrial projects, supplying vehicles, and constructing infrastructure facilities.
The company expressed interest in implementing projects in Uzbekistan within the rare earth metals and clean energy sectors. Among the promising areas highlighted were the construction of solar and biomass-based power plants.
Amb.Vakhabov emphasized that the dynamic growth of Uzbekistan's economy and the consistent improvement of the investment climate create broad opportunities for joint projects with foreign partners.

A priority is the development of renewable energy, a sector in which Uzbekistan leads Central Asia in terms of foreign direct investment. Specifically, between 2003 and 2025, Uzbekistan accounted for 56% of the total foreign investment directed into Central Asia's renewable energy sector, which reached nearly $18 billion.
Following the meeting, an agreement was reached to explore opportunities for implementing renewable energy projects in the country, as well as to develop cooperation in logistics and industrial infrastructure.
